Transaction e63d77a9c709313ea27888eacf07dadc89fe14da8a3e00c4db8ba5ae4ca1b86a

block
918f45f30fa760a3dfdd6529f0622badb76bfc9e87a41e42203799c67d71460e

60 Inputs

2 Outputs